    What unit(s) did you serve in with the 2d Cavalry?

    1/2 ACR I served in headquartrs company as a medic.


    Where were you stationed?

    I was stationed in Bindlach (Christensen Barracks) and also a Howitzer Battery in Bayreuth


    What MOS or job description did you have?

    Field Medic


    What was your rank/title?

    SP4


    What years were you assigned to the 2nd Cavalry?

    May 1972 - October 1974


    Tell us a little about your cav days.

    I served as a medic. We were a very close group that worked at the dispensary as well as the Camp Hof and Camp Gates


    Tell us a little about you now.

    I have been teaching for about 25 yrs and presently teach 4th grade in Rapid City, SD I am an avid bikder and ride a Harley-Davidson My long white beard makes it possible for me to be Santa each Christmas
